As a HVAC/Refrigeration Mechanic at the state-of-the-art new St. Paul's Hospital opening in Vancouver in 2027, you'll play a critical role in maintaining the complex environmental systems that help keep a high-performing healthcare facility safe, comfortable and efficient for patients, staff and visitors. This includes: Install, repair and maintain heating, ventilation, air conditioning and refrigeration systems across a large, dynamic hospital environment. Perform preventative maintenance to ensure HVAC/R systems operate reliably and meet strict healthcare, safety and regulatory standards. Troubleshoot and repair air handling units, compressors, pumps, fans, motors, controls and refrigeration equipment. Operate and program Building Automation Systems (BAS) to optimize system performance and efficiency. Perform air balancing tests and system inspections to maintain proper airflow and environmental conditions. Work closely with other skilled trades and Facilities teams to support day-to-day operations and long-term infrastructure projects.
